我创建了一个自定义eclipse编辑器:
public class MyEditor extends AbstractDecoratedTextEditor {
我想添加一个每次更改行或更改光标位置时执行的监听器。
感谢。
答案 0 :(得分:2)
您可以使用StyledText
addCaretListener
来听取插入符号的移动。
在MyEditor
班级中使用:
StyledText styledText = (StyledText)getAdapter(Control.class);
styledText.addCaretListener(listener);